Holly Willoughby is set to hilariously get her revenge on Ant and Dec during this weekend's Saturday Night Takeaway finale.

In a preview clip for this Saturday's (April 13) 'Get Me Out of Ear' segment, celebrities once again turn the tables on the presenting duo as they give commands in public spaces through earpieces.

In the clip, Ant and Dec are at a restaurant, though Holly goes all out as she tells Dec to get up and ask the waiter where the toilets are.

She then tells him to say: "Where can I find the toilets? Because I need a poo poo."

Sure enough, he reluctantly obliges, leaving the waiter laughing, Holly then commanding Dec: "[Make] lots of straining noises. 'I need to go now! I really need a poo!'"

Rylan Clark then tells Ant to stand up and shout to the entire restaurant: "I miss my best friend!", which he does.

Olly Murs and Oti Mabuse also have a go, Olly getting the pair to act like spoiled celebrities and start a chant in the restaurant demanding their food – and some other customers even join in.

The segment comes after the likes of Britain’s Got Talent's Simon Cowell and Amanda Holden, as well as Dermot O’Leary, Alison Hammond, Craig David and Richard Madeley got a chance to embarrass Ant and Dec last weekend.

Speaking previously about the tables being turned on the two, Ant said: “Normally when you're trying to get celebrities for things like this it's hard to pin them down because of busy diaries. But we've been told that everyone who they asked immediately said yes and made themself available.”

This weekend's finale will be extended to two hours, with guests including Ashley Roberts, S Club, Scarlett Moffatt, Andi Peters, Kaiser Chiefs, Jordan North and Tony Hadley all taking part, while Girls Aloud will be the Star Guest announcers.

Ant & Dec's Saturday Night Takeaway airs on ITV1.
